| Informal and comprehensive human-readable definition of a concept. Description | This category includes data quality rules that verify whether an administrative area value is valid for its associated country. Administrative areas include states, provinces, regions, counties, and other first-level administrative divisions. The validation checks whether the provided value exists in authoritative reference data for that country. Invalid values might result from typos, outdated information, use of incorrect naming conventions, or mismatched country-region combinations. For example, specifying 'California' for an address in Germany would be flagged as invalid. Accurate administrative area data is essential for proper address formatting, mail delivery, tax calculations, and geographic analytics. This validation supports the Accuracy dimension by ensuring administrative areas exist and are correctly associated with their countries. |
